Tips on How to Organize Luncheon Events in Seattle
Organizing a luncheon in Seattle comes with its own unique set of challenges. From finding the best venues to deciding on catering services, there is much to take into consideration when planning a successful event. Here are some tips and tricks to help you organize an amazing luncheon in Seattle:
- Make sure to do your research when selecting a venue. Take time to visit different venues in Seattle, so you know exactly what they offer, and decide which one best suits your needs. Be sure to inquire about their availability, cost, size, and staff services.
- Consider the type of event you’re planning. It’s important to make sure the venue will be appropriate for the purpose of your luncheon. For example, if it’s a corporate luncheon, you’ll likely want an elegant space with enough room for everyone involved.
- Think about the ambiance of the space. Choose a venue with pleasant decorations, comfortable seating, and adequate lighting that matches your desired atmosphere and theme.
- Find out whether or not the venue provides catering services. If they do, ask what types of food they offer (e.g., vegetarian options). If they don’t provide such services, then consider hiring an outside caterer or having guests bring their own food items from home.
- Get creative with your seating plan! Incorporate different styles like long tables, round tables, or booths for a more engaging environment that encourages conversation amongst attendees.
- Have plenty of activities prepared for guests during lunch break so everyone feels engaged throughout the event. This could include icebreaker games, speakers, or giveaways; it all depends on what kind of mood you want to create for your gathering!
Famous Locations in Seattle
- Waterfall Garden Park
The Waterfall Garden Park provides a space for relaxation for busy city-dwellers who need a break from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. It’s a man-made waterfall that overlooks a two-tiered patio with tables and chairs, making it an ideal spot to relax with a good book or enjoy lunch or coffee while taking in the stunning view. The park is also well-maintained, so visitors can be sure that it will be a pleasant experience every time they visit.
- Wing Luke Museum
The Wing Luke Museum of the Asian-Pacific American Experience is a must-visit for those who want to know about the history and culture of the neighborhood. It offers exhibitions on different topics, including Seattle's Asian pioneer history and the life of Bruce Lee. Visitors can also take part in a guided tour and get an insider look at its sights and sounds.
- Kerry Park
Few places in Seattle offer such a stunning and unobstructed view of the cityscape as this park. This beloved Queen Anne spot has long been a favorite of locals and visitors alike, thanks to its sweeping panorama of downtown, Elliott Bay, and Mount Rainier on clear days. The park is especially popular at sunset when the city lights up, and the sky turns beautiful shades of orange and pink.
